ABSTRACT:
A cassette type recording and reproducing apparatus in which during an eject operation of a tape cassette, a cam driven lever is kicked by a cam and a cassette discharge lever is rotated by the cam driven lever, whereby a tape cassette in a cassette stage is pushed out in a cassette discharge direction by the cassette discharge lever. The cam driven lever is positionally regulated with some degree of freedom within a fixed range .theta..sub.12 at the intermediate position of a swing range .theta..sub.11 in which the cam driven lever is rotated by the cam. Therefore, the cam driven lever is prevented from violently colliding against a cassette discharge lever in the course of a cassette loading operation.
